is a British-American historical drama that chronicles the events leading up to and including the Trojan War. Developed by David Farr (known for The Night Manager ), the series focuses on the love story between Paris, prince of Troy, and Helen, queen of Sparta, and the catastrophic war that follows. If Hector is the heart of the show, Agamemnon (Johnny Harris) is its terrifying spine. Harris plays the King of Mycenae with a terrifying, quiet intensity. He is not a shouting, moustache-twirling villain; he is a calculating brute. He understands that the war for Helen is a convenient excuse to conquer Troy and secure dominance over the Aegean.
